Overview: IBEX Limited offers comprehensive technology-enabled customer lifecycle experience solutions globally and has a market cap of $326.58 million.
Operations: IBEX Limited generates revenue primarily from its Business Process Outsourcing segment, which accounts for $513.68 million. The company's market cap stands at $326.58 million.
IBEX, a nimble player in the professional services sector, has shown commendable financial health with no debt and high-quality earnings. Over the past five years, its earnings have surged at an impressive 41.4% annually. Despite trading at a significant discount of 76.9% below estimated fair value, IBEX's recent quarterly results reveal steady growth with sales reaching US$129.72 million and net income at US$7.53 million for Q1 2025. The company repurchased shares worth US$3.13 million recently, reflecting confidence in its valuation amidst ongoing expansion efforts like their new AI solutions and Honduras operations enlargement.

Overview: Jiayin Group Inc., with a market cap of $345.77 million, operates in the People’s Republic of China offering online consumer finance services through its subsidiaries.
Operations: Jiayin Group generates revenue primarily from its online consumer finance services, amounting to CN¥6.02 billion. The company reports a market cap of $345.77 million.
Jiayin Group, a relatively small player in the financial sector, showcases a mixed performance. Despite trading at 89% below its estimated fair value, its net profit margin has slipped to 20% from last year's 31.9%. The company remains debt-free, which eliminates concerns about interest coverage. Recent earnings reports indicate sales of CNY 1.48 billion for Q2 2024 and net income of CNY 238 million, reflecting a dip from the previous year’s figures. Notably volatile share prices have been observed over recent months. Additionally, Jiayin completed a significant share buyback program worth US$13.9 million this year.

Overview: EZCORP, Inc. operates pawn services in the United States and Latin America with a market capitalization of $644.29 million.
Operations: The company generates revenue primarily from its U.S. Pawn segment at $818.54 million and Latin America Pawn segment at $318.95 million, with a negligible contribution from Other Investments.
EZCORP has been making waves with its strategic expansions in Latin America and the U.S., focusing on boosting market share through new stores and online growth. The company reported a strong financial performance, with full-year revenue reaching US$1.16 billion, up from US$1.05 billion last year, while net income more than doubled to US$83.1 million from US$38.46 million previously. Its price-to-earnings ratio of 8.3x suggests good value compared to the broader market's 19.1x, supported by high-quality earnings and satisfactory debt levels at a net debt-to-equity ratio of 17.9%.
